Have an order shipped by "Aquiline", how screwed am I?

Never heard of the shipper, looked them up and top results are to discussions indicating it's presence might be indicative of a scam. Of course I can't cancel the order now that it's marked "shipped", and I have to just wait and see.

 

Is this a known scam? How screwed am I? Is ebay going to insist I got it because there's a "tracking number" involved? I'd hate to have to do a chargeback since ebay is my alternative to amazon.

Have an order shipped by "Aquiline", how screwed am I?

Aquiline is not a shipper. It's a backend system that converts tracking numbers from shippers whose tracking numbers aren't compatible with eBay to a tracking number that can be read by eBay's system. It's most commonly used by sellers using Fulfilled by Amazon, where their goods are warehoused and fulfilled at Amazon and delivered by Amazon drivers. It's no more a scam than Bluecare or any of the other systems that do the same thing. The complaints come because when there are delivery issues it's very difficult to resolve them. Long story short, it's quite likely your package is being delivered by an Amazon driver.
